Mike Trout, Angels play Warriors in PIG (Video)

Mike Trout and the Los Angeles Angels decided to drop by Golden State Warriors practice for a little game of PIG.

There’s nothing quite like seeing star players from different sports take each other on in their respective sports. On Tuesday, the Los Angeles Angels got to check out the buzz that is the Golden State Warriors and watch the Warriors practice a day before they try to make NBA history and win their 73rd game of the season.

While getting to watch the best team in the NBA practice was cool enough as is, the Angels decided to get in on the action and there were a couple of games of horse that went on during practice.

Angels superstar outfielder Mike Trout decided to take on Draymond Green in a game of PIG, which as everyone knows, is the game where you try to defeat your opponent with crazy trick shots.

In a rather shocking result, Trout would defeat Green in a result that almost no one expected.

After Green lost to Trout on his own floor, Stephen Curry decided to step up and pick up his teammate by taking on the Angels’ right-handed reliever Joe Smith. A reliever going up against the NBA MVP and league’s best shooter in a game of PIG seems almost unfair.

So naturally, Smith ended up winning and no one was sure what had just happened.

The Warriors went down in a clean sweep in their own game to a couple of baseball players. Perhaps Curry and Green should challenge them to a home run derby, because none of this makes a lick of sense.

In the end, the Angels presented Curry with a jersey and they posed for a photo opportunity.

The Warriors will now go for win No. 73 against the Grizzlies on Wednesday night, but if they shoot like they did against a baseball team, then history might be on hold.
